How to Calculate Your Fishing Time Multiplier
Calculating your own fishing time multiplier begins with tracking your fishing activities. Here’s a simple method to get you started:
- Gather data on your fishing outings, including the duration of each trip and the number of catches.
- Calculate your catch per hour for each outing. For example, if you caught 5 fish in a 2-hour trip, your catch rate would be 2.5 fish per hour.
- Identify the best times and conditions under which you had your highest catch rates. This could include specific times of day, seasons, or weather conditions.
- Use this information to create a multiplier. For instance, if your best catch rate is double your average, your fishing time multiplier is 2.
Tips for Maximizing Your Fishing Time Multiplier
Having a fishing time multiplier is only the beginning. Here are a few tips to help you maximize your fishing time based on this concept:

1. Choose Your Fishing Spots Wisely
Identify locations that historically yield better catches. Use local knowledge or online resources to find hotspots. Fishing in the right place can drastically increase your multiplier.
2. Utilize Technology
Consider using fishing apps that provide data on fish activity patterns based on lunar phases, weather conditions, and tide schedules. The more informed you are, the better your chances of success.
3. Experiment with Techniques
Don’t be afraid to switch things up. If your usual bait or lures aren’t producing, try different techniques. Variety can help you identify what works best in specific conditions.
4. Network with Other Anglers
Engaging with other fishing enthusiasts can provide valuable insights and tips on improving your fishing time multiplier. Sharing experiences and knowledge helps the entire community thrive.
5. Keep a Fishing Journal
Documenting your fishing trips can help you track patterns in your catches over time, allowing you to refine your multiplier and improve your fishing strategies.
